About This Deal

Microsoft Corporation acquired ScreenTonic, a transaction announced in May 2007.

ScreenTonic operates in Online Services Group (Microsoft Digital Advertising Solutions), is based in Paris, France. ScreenTonic provided mobile advertising solutions, including display and text ad formats, ad management and reporting for mobile operators and publishers. Microsoft acquired it to combine its digital advertising offerings with ScreenTonic's mobile expertise and operator relationships.
